Richard Branson and Jeff Bezos Ventures Open Space Travel to All

Richard Branson and Jeff Bezos Ventures Open Space Travel to All Branson, Bezos ventures may open space travel to all. Launch of a new era or flights of fancy? Richard Branson and Jeff Bezos have brought renewed attention to space travel with their journeys, but their ventures have also drawn criticism. The space travel pursuits … Read more